What You'll Be Doing On an average day, you’ll Prepare winding forms and gather materials like insulation, copper tubing, and strapping. Set up winding/tensioning equipment. Wind up to 6 conductors onto the winding mold or block per the engineering prints and install insulating materials. Perform quality checks of the finished product before it moves to the next area.
